Folks, Chevy Stevens does it AGAIN with another five star read. This book is told in 3 parts (swipe for book description). Part one is told in 1st person, part two is told in 3rd person and part three switches between 1st and 3rd person. I absolutely loved this style. It totally worked for this book. I absolutely loved the characters, mainly Hailey and Wolf but found myself invested in all of the characters. This book was a page-turner and I ended up binge reading most of it on a long car ride. If you haven’t read any Chevy Stevens, I don’t know what you’re waiting for but I highly recommend you pick up one of her books (this one included)!  This was one of my most anticipated books this year and it definitely lived up to my expectations.

wow !! what an amazing story !! This was my first Chevy Stevens book and Im OBSESSED!! 

Girls have been found dead along Cold Creek Highway and the killer has not been caught. Hailey is a 17 year old just trying to live her life after her parents both died. Unfortunately, living with her horrible uncle Vaugn as been nothing but a nightmare for her. She discovers something horrible and decides to run away, deep in the woods where no one can find her. While there, she finds the body of another girl, her girlfriend Amber and is convinced she knows who the killer is. She is determined to catch him. A year later, Ambers sister Beth decides she needs to go to Cold Creek for closure on her sisters murder. What she finds is so much more, and definitely worse. 

I really loved this book so much !! This book had 3 parts: Hailey (in first person), Beth (in third person), and alternating. I loved how she incorporated more than one POV. I love seeing how the same story effects different Characters. The characters were all great... so easy to love and some very easy to hate. I also really loved that she included even more info into the prologue and epilogue to add more detention to the story in a completely different way. This story was based off a true story, so it made more of an impact knowing that the tragic things that happened to these girls, really happened. 

I will definitely be picking up more of Chevy Stevens Books in the future !! Highly Recommend!
